I can't type it. Ha ha. [chonglei] is a kind of shellfish at the estuary of the Pearl River. Its flesh is thick, tender, sweet and fat. Its shell is yellowish brown and its flesh is white and clean. It can be found on the beach after low tide. It's very delicious when it's cooked. People here like to use radish to cook, or barbecue, can reflect its fresh and sweet. It's not expensive either. It's about 3 or 4 yuan per kilo. You can buy more than ten yuan to support you, but the shell is thick, ha ha. "
